What is a Hong Kong Dollar?

The Hong Kong Dollar (HK$) is the official currency of Hong Kong. It is pegged to the US dollar and is a major currency in international finance.

What is a Chilean Peso?

The Chilean Peso (CLP$) is the official currency of Chile.
